Saturday Hustle – Voice Mail
The entertainment fraternity was turned upside down on Monday as people learned that Voice Mail member Oniel Edwards was shot by gunmen. Saturday Hustle is jiving to the group’s hottest tracks.
Nuh Behaviour
One of the group’s recent hit, Nuh Behaviour is inspired by the street dance of the same name made popular by local dancer Ovamars. The song is featured on the Tripple Bounce Riddim.
Get Crazy
Always stirring dancehall fans to move, Get Crazy from the trio’s 2006 album Hey is a club-ready dance track that encourages party patrons to loose themselves in the euphoria of dance.
Style and Swagga
Long known as dancehall’s dappers (they’ve got the Style Observer People’s Choice Award to prove it), it was no surprise when the trio came with this fresh ode to fashion and charisma, which was released earlier this year.
Dance the Night Away
Merging dancehall with electric pop, the trio opted for a more internationally appealing sound on this one. And it didn’t hurt, too, that they enlisted the lyrically lethal Busy Signal to give the track some in-the-streets edge.
Best Days of My Life
This track is a departure from the group’s usual club-banging material, reflecting on a softer side that speaks to love, relationships and the importance of having an understanding woman.
